SN55 XDZ is a 2006 Porsche Cayenne in Silver with a 3,189c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.6%.
Across all 2006 Porsche Cayenne models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.9% with a typical mileage of 78,318 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Porsche Cayenne f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 5,217 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SN55 XDZ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Porsche Cayenne typ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 20 years old, this Porsche Cayenne is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
